With oversight and direction from the Medical Education Manager, the Program Coordinator is responsible for the coordination of daily activities and operations as it pertains to Medical Education trainees, with a primary focus on the Family Medicine and Leadership Preventive Medicine Residencies and associated requirements through the Accreditation Council of Graduate Medical Education (ACGME), the American Board of Family Medicine (ABFM) or other governing accrediting organization(s). The Program Coordinator is a resource for Residency Program Directors, teaching faculty and providers, residents and Practice Managers of the Family Health Centers, and collaborates across the healthcare enterprise.
